E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
邻接表
算法笔记-第十章-图的遍历(未处理完-11.22日)
算法笔记-第十章-图的遍历图遍历的知识点一关于深度和广度优先遍历的基础知识:大佬讲解一大佬讲解二图遍历知识二连通分量实现DFS的模板思路邻接矩阵版本
邻接表
版本无向图的连通块图遍历的知识点一关于深度和广度优先遍历的基础知识
一直爱莲子
·
2023-11-22 18:48
#
算法笔记刷题
算法
笔记
深度优先
算法笔记-第十章-图的存储
算法笔记-第十章-图的存储图的基础知识图的邻接矩阵和
邻接表
大佬讲解无向图的邻接矩阵有向图的邻接矩阵无向图的
邻接表
有向图的
邻接表
图的基础知识1.
邻接表
是图的一种链式存储结构,而邻接矩阵是图的一种顺序存储结构
一直爱莲子
·
2023-11-22 18:44
#
算法笔记刷题
算法
笔记
《数据结构与算法》(十二)- 图详解
目录前言1.图的定义1.1各种图的定义1.2图的顶点与边间关系1.3连通图的相关术语1.4图的定义与术语总结2.图的抽象数据类型3.图的存储结构3.1邻接矩阵3.2
邻接表
3.3十字链表3.4邻接多重表3.5
大Null
·
2023-11-22 17:46
数据结构与算法
数据结构
算法
图论
数据结构——图-基本知识点(第七章)
目录1.图的定义1.1各种图定义1.2图的顶点与边间关系1.3连通图相关术语1.4图的定义与术语总结2.图的抽象数据类型3.图的存储结构3.1邻接矩阵3.2
邻接表
3.3十字链表3.4邻接多重表3.5边集数组
Change_Improve
·
2023-11-22 17:06
数据结构
图
数据结构
图
数据结构 图
邻接表
n个点,每个点都有一个单链表,每个点的单链表存储该点可以到达的点
何hyy
·
2023-11-22 09:16
数据结构
数据结构
图
连通图中是否有环
假设一个连通图采用
邻接表
作为存储结构,试设计一个算法,判断其中是否存在经过顶点v的回路。并查集(检验图中是否有环)
猫的玖月
·
2023-11-22 00:12
ACM竞赛(C++)
数据结构
图论
Python 数据结构 —— 图
1.图的存储方式1.1图的存储数据结构图可以用邻接矩阵和
邻接表
(AdjacencyList)来表示,当边数不多的时候,使用
邻接表
存储效率更高如存储下面的图:对应的
邻接表
为:1.2字典实现
邻接表
采用字典实现
邻接表
很方便
我有两颗糖
·
2023-11-21 19:07
Python
数据结构与算法
python
第2关:图的深度遍历
任务要求参考答案评论2任务描述相关知识编程要求测试说明任务描述本关任务:以
邻接表
存储图,要求编写程序实现图的深度优先遍历。
toptopniba
·
2023-11-21 16:58
深度优先
算法
第3关:图的广度遍历
500任务要求参考答案评论2任务描述相关知识编程要求测试说明任务描述本关任务:以
邻接表
存储图,要求编写程序实现图的广度优先遍历。相关知识广度优先遍历类似于树的按层次遍历的过程。
toptopniba
·
2023-11-21 16:58
数据结构
31 图的
邻接表
:深度优先遍历
31图的
邻接表
:深度优先遍历作者:冯向阳时间限制:1S章节:DS:图截止日期:2022-06-3023:55:00问题描述:目的:使用C++模板设计并逐步完善图的
邻接表
抽象数据类型(ADT)。
杨骅麟(Patrick Young)
·
2023-11-21 16:23
东华大学数据结构OJ
深度优先
算法
数据结构详细笔记——图
文章目录图的定义图的存储邻接矩阵法
邻接表
法邻接矩阵法与
邻接表
法的区别图的基本操作图的遍历广度优先遍历(BFS)深度优先遍历(DFS)图的遍历和图的连通性图的定义图G由顶点集V和边集E组成,记为G=(V,
哎哟喂_!
·
2023-11-20 16:34
数据结构
数据结构
笔记
图论
数据结构与算法-图
图2.图的存储结构2.4.2
邻接表
的存储✅2.4.2.1逆
邻接表
✅2.4.2.2
邻接表
存储结构的定义✅2.4.2.3
邻接表
存储结构的类定义✅2.4.2.4创建n个顶点m条边的无向网✅2.4.2.5创建n
一口⁵个团子
·
2023-11-19 18:06
初阶数据结构与算法
深度优先
算法
c++
c语言
Acwing视频课学习笔记——树和图的DFS/BFS
树与图的存储两种存储方式,树始终特殊的图,树是无环连通图图分为有向图和无向图,而无向图属于一种特殊的有向图——所以实际上就是研究有向图有向图分为两类:邻接矩阵、
邻接表
//树和图的存储主要就是邻接矩阵或者
邻接表
kumu的Java奇幻冒险
·
2023-11-19 17:30
数据结构和算法杂谈
深度优先
学习
宽度优先
Acwing算法基础课学习笔记(四)--数据结构之单链表&&双链表&&模拟栈&&模拟队列&&单调栈&&单调队列&&KMP
单链表算法题中最常考的单链表就是
邻接表
(用来存储图和数),比如最短路问题,最小生成树问题,最大流问题。双链表用于优化某些问题。利用数组来表达单链表:存储值和指针的两个数组利用下标进行关联。
nullwh
·
2023-11-19 17:59
学习笔记
刷题练习
Acwing
数据结构(一)——链表与
邻接表
、栈与队列、KMP
肝就完了2月15日,day03打卡今日已学完y总的算法基础课-2.1-第二章数据结构(一)共7题,知识点如下链表与
邻接表
:单链表、双链表栈与队列:模拟栈、模拟队列单调栈、单调队列:滑动窗口(题目名)KMP
.浮尘.
·
2023-11-19 17:56
#
acwing算法基础课
算法
学习
数据结构
AcWing的算法基础课目录
文章目录基础算法数据结构搜索与图论数学知识动态规划贪心时空复杂度分析基础算法排序二分高精度前缀和与差分双指针算法位运算离散化区间合并数据结构链表与
邻接表
:树与图的存储栈与队列:单调队列、单调栈kmpTrie
greedy-hat
·
2023-11-19 06:21
刷题
mysql
学习
spring
boot
Trie——字典树
洛谷P8306字典树板子题#includeusingnamespacestd;intn,q;constintN=3e6+10;structTrie{intvim[N][150],idx;//
邻接表
,idx
蒻蒻
·
2023-11-19 02:54
Trie树
算法
HDU 4738Caocao's Bridges
邻接表
tarjan 割桥
Caocao'sBridgesTimeLimit:2000/1000MS(Java/Others)MemoryLimit:32768/32768K(Java/Others)ProblemDescriptionCaocaowasdefeatedbyZhugeLiangandZhouYuinthebattleofChibi.Buthewouldn'tgiveup.Caocao'sarmystillwa
fzw_captain
·
2023-11-19 01:04
ACM-tarjan
数据结构-第六章 图-笔记
目录邻接矩阵的阶乘性质例一:例二:图的存储邻接矩阵法
邻接表
法(完整版)
邻接表
法(简化版)十字链表法(只能存储有向图)邻接多重表(只能存储无向图)吉大版本的三元组表和十字链表图的部分基本操作在图中插入新结点在图中删除结点图的遍历无向图的广度优先遍历
作用太大了销夜
·
2023-11-18 19:04
吉大计专专业课
-
考研复习专题
数据结构
数据结构 链表
单链表:单链表用来写
邻接表
,
邻接表
用来存储图和树双链表:用来优化某些问题单链表链式存储#include#includeintcont=0;//结构体typedefstructList{intdata;/
何hyy
·
2023-11-17 09:51
数据结构
数据结构
链表
【10套模拟】【5】
关键字:数据的最小单位、归并排序(两两归并)、单链表顺序存取、
邻接表
表头顶点顺序存储随机访问、三角矩阵元素个数、堆的性质、冒泡排序、二叉树是否相同
irel1a_3
·
2023-11-16 19:24
10模拟
数据结构
数据结构 第6章(图)
目录1.图的定义和基本术语1.1图的定义1.2图的基本术语2.图的存储结构2.1邻接矩阵2.1.1邻接矩阵表示法2.1.2采用邻接矩阵表示法创建无向网2.1.3邻接矩阵表示法的优缺点测试代码2.2
邻接表
His Last Bow
·
2023-11-16 10:31
数据结构
数据结构
第3章:搜索与图论【AcWing】
文章目录图的概念图的概念图的分类有向图和无向图连通性连通块重边和自环稠密图和稀疏图参考资料图的存储方式
邻接表
代码邻接矩阵DFS全排列问题题目描述思路回溯标记剪枝代码时间复杂度[N皇后问题](https:
Man9Oo
·
2023-11-16 08:16
算法基础
图论
BFS
DFS
拓扑序列
最短路
最小生成树
二分图
数据结构——带头双向循环链表
实际中更多是作为其他数据结构的子结构,如哈希桶、图的
邻接表
等等。另外这
结衣结衣.
·
2023-11-16 03:53
数据结构
链表
c语言
算法
笔记
【算法每日一练]-图论(保姆级教程 篇1(模板篇)) #floyed算法 #dijkstra算法 #spfa算法
dijkstra算法:spfa算法:图的存储其实:邻接矩阵和链式向前星都能存边的信息,vector只能存点的信息,再搭配上v[]便可存点的权值,如果是树的话也建议vector)邻接矩阵:(可存边信息)
邻接表
亦歌希望你变强啊
·
2023-11-15 22:47
算法
c++
图论
数据结构
深度优先
动态规划
建图的三种方式---邻接矩阵,
邻接表
,链式前向星
邻接矩阵#includeusingnamespacestd;constintmaxn=1e3;intgraph[maxn][maxn];voidinit(intn,intm){//邻接矩阵for(inti=1;i>x1>>y1>>c1;graph[x1][y1]=c1;//有向图//graph[x1][y1]=graph[y1][x1]=c1;//无向图}}voidprint(intn,intm)
扎刺
·
2023-11-15 22:11
暑训
数据结构
LC1334. 阈值距离内邻居最少的城市
deffindTheCity(self,n,edges,distanceThreshold):INTMAX=0x3f3f3f3fmp=[[INTMAX]*nforiinrange(n)]forx,y,tinedges:#建立
邻接表
996冲冲冲
·
2023-11-15 07:17
图
最短路径算法
图论
算法
leetcode
模拟散列表(哈希表)模板
include#includeusingnamespacestd;constintN=100003;//取大于1e5的第一个质数,取质数冲突的概率最小intn;inth[N],e[N],ne[N],idx;//
邻接表
B0tton
·
2023-11-15 00:39
算法笔记
散列表
图论
c++
模拟哈希表两种方法
哈希表的两种方法1.拉链法拉链法主要用于冲突避免,即,如果两个或多个数都经过映射操作到达哈希表上相同的位置,则拉根链子出来,类似于
邻接表
,如下图所示2.开放寻址法**开放寻址法,理解为,如果对于x,一开始在哈希表上映射是
atm7758258
·
2023-11-15 00:37
散列表
链表
数据结构
数据结构-图【广度优先遍历图解&C++代码实现】
图解BFS&C++代码实现1BFS算法图解1.1基本算法流程伪代码1.2算法流程图解2代码实现2.1宏定义与头文件包含2.2边表类-ArcNode2.3顶点类-VNode2.4
邻接表
类-ALGraph3
是席木木啊
·
2023-11-14 14:51
数据结构
C/C++
数据结构
图
BFS广度优先遍历
C++
JS算法:广度优先搜索(BSF)的理解
也就是将每个节点初始化为白色未读2.声明和创建一个队列Queue实例,用于储存待访问和待探索的顶点3.将我们的起始的顶点加入队列4.然后我们就进入循环,循环的条件是队列不为空(1)循环第一步:我们从队列中移除一个顶点,并通过
邻接表
Me_禹城人
·
2023-11-14 14:21
算法
算法
深度搜索和广度搜索领接表实现_简单无向图(
邻接表
实现及深度优先和广度优先算法)...
数据结构图图这种数据结构体接触的很少,在这里记录一下最简单的无向图,以及其相关的BreadthFirstSearch,DepthFirstSearch算法这里使用
邻接表
实现
邻接表
邻接表
.gif在代码中的表现就比如这样
YY硕
·
2023-11-14 14:51
深度搜索和广度搜索领接表实现
数据结构上机实验——图的实现(以无向
邻接表
为例)、图的深度优先搜索(DFS)、图的广度优先搜索(BFS)
文章目录数据结构上机实验1.要求2.图的实现(以无向
邻接表
为例)2.1创建图2.1.1定义图的顶点、边及类定义2.1.2创建无向图和查找2.1.3插入边2.1.4打印函数2.2图的深度优先搜索(DFS)
鳄鱼麻薯球
·
2023-11-14 14:55
数据结构
数据结构
图的结构模板及遍历
常用的表示图的方法有两种:1、
邻接表
法将一个点的邻居都列出来。
鬼鬼写bug
·
2023-11-14 07:07
左神算法与数据结构
算法
二分图判定+二分图最大匹配
判定模板
邻接表
#includeusingnamespacestd;intn,m;vectornode[205];//一个神奇的模拟
邻接表
的“超方便”的东西intcolour[205];booldfs(inta
3.14159265358979323
·
2023-11-13 05:06
链式前向星模板
可以用
邻接表
来实现
邻接表
建图,两种方法:1.链表2.链式前向行只讲第二种,比较常用简洁链式前向星模板#defineIOSios::sync_with_stdio(false);cin.tie(0);cout.tie
clmm_
·
2023-11-13 05:59
c++
算法
图论
NetworkX入门及实战教程
NetworkX入门及实战教程环境要求和工具包安装自带图的绘制连接表和
邻接表
创建图通过连接表edgelist创建图可视化查看全图参数保存并载入
邻接表
用NetworkX创建图创建空图添加单个节点添加多个节点添加带属性的节点可视化
总是重复名字我很烦啊
·
2023-11-13 05:39
图机器学习
图深度学习
图网络系列
python
图-最小生成树-Prim与Kruskal算法
最小生成树文章目录最小生成树Prim算法基本思想具体实现邻接矩阵版
邻接表
版Kruskal算法基本思想具体实现最小生成树(MinimumSpanningTree,MST)是在一个给定的无向图G(V,E)中求一棵树
veeupup
·
2023-11-12 08:18
数据结构和算法
数据结构
算法
图论
c++
图论12-无向带权图及实现
每个输入的adj节点链接新的TreeMap,存储相邻的边和权重privateTreeMap[]adj;adj=newTreeMap[V];for(inti=0;i();两条边相连,则分别把权重加入各自的
邻接表
中
大大枫
·
2023-11-12 08:14
图论
图论
【ACwing】三、 搜索与图论:拓扑排序—— AcWing 848. 有向图的拓扑序列
(3)思路:(4)代码复盘易出错的位置(1)知识点+模板模板:(2)题目原题链接:https://www.acwing.com/problem/content/850/(3)思路:根据输入的a、b创建
邻接表
Nefu_lyh
·
2023-11-12 01:58
算法面试题
面试
算法
拓扑学
图论-拓扑排序(有向图)
include#include#includeusingnamespacestd;intans=1,flagCycle=0;//开始时间初值标志位-是否存在回路vectortp;//拓扑系列vector>g;//
邻接表
Fight_adu
·
2023-11-12 01:55
算法
算法
图论
建立二叉树:已知层次遍历顺序建立二叉树、已知先序遍历顺序建立二叉树
(链式存储)三、已知节点关系,建立二叉树(
邻接表
存储)四、已知先序和中序遍历顺序,建立二叉树。前提知识:约定:约定二叉树的内容为int类型,并且都>=1,0代表是空节点。
马小超i
·
2023-11-11 23:35
数据结构和算法
邻接表
储存图实现广度优先遍历(C++)
目录基本要求:
邻接表
的结构体:图的
邻接表
创建:图的广度优先遍历(BFS):
邻接表
的打印输出:完整代码:测试数据:结果运行:通过给出的图的顶点和边的信息,构建无向图的
邻接表
存储结构。
取名真难.
·
2023-11-11 19:54
宽度优先
c++
深度优先
《算法竞赛进阶指南》 题解(更新中
《算法竞赛进阶指南》全套题解&索引目录1.基本算法位运算递推与递归前缀和&差分二分排序倍增贪心总结与练习2.基本数据结构栈队列链表与
邻接表
Hash字符串Trie二叉堆总结与练习3.搜索树与图的遍历深度优先搜索剪枝迭代加深广度优先搜索广搜变形
DataPlayerK
·
2023-11-11 14:34
算法
算法
数据结构
acm竞赛
leetcode
hdu1839之二分+
邻接表
+Dijkstra+队列优化
DelayConstrainedMaximumCapacityPathTimeLimit:10000/10000MS(Java/Others)MemoryLimit:65535/65535K(Java/Others)TotalSubmission(s):544AcceptedSubmission(s):192ProblemDescriptionConsideranundirectedgraphwi
星天93
·
2023-11-11 02:18
最短路
acwing算法基础之搜索与图论--树与图的遍历
目录1基础知识2模板3工程化1基础知识树和图的存储:邻接矩阵、
邻接表
。树和图的遍历:dfs、bfs。2模板树是一种特殊的图(即,无环连通图),与图的存储方式相同。
YMWM_
·
2023-11-09 23:21
C++学习
Acwing
算法
图论
深度优先
蓝桥杯双周赛算法心得——串门(双链表数组+双dfs)
大家好,我是晴天学长,树和dfs的结合,其
邻接表
的存图方法也很重要。需要的小伙伴可以关注支持一下哦!后续会继续更新的。
晴天学长
·
2023-11-08 08:43
算法
算法
蓝桥杯
深度优先
动态规划:树形DP
includeusingnamespacestd;constintN=6010;intn;inthappy[N];//每个职工的高兴度intf[N][2];//N1表示选这个点,N2表示不选这个点inte[N],ne[N],h[N],idx;//
邻接表
友纪YuKi
·
2023-11-07 11:26
算法基础
动态规划
深度优先
图论
洛谷P2910 [USACO08OPEN]Clear And Present Danger S题解
邻接表
&&邻接矩阵都不用!)
2301_76268817
·
2023-11-07 00:20
C++
算法
c++
开发语言
图的存储结构-十字链表
可以看成是将有向图的
邻接表
和逆
邻接表
结合起来得到的一种链表。在十字链表中,对应于有向图中每一条弧有一个结点,对应于每个顶点也有一个结点。十字链表的结构顶点结点typedefstring
老攀呀
·
2023-11-06 19:54
数据结构
链表
数据结构
算法
上一页
1
2
3
4
5
6
7
8
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他